    Hercule Poirot

    I find that Dame Agatha Christie is the greatest crime writer ever. Her ingenuity lies in her ability to surprise the reader each time with the real criminal. Her best book was "The Murder of Roger Ackroyd" because the murderer is a BIG surprise. The character of Hercule Poirot is one of literature's greatest creations and his powers of deduction are SUPER. He is a more eccentric detective than Sherlock Holmes and I find him more amusing.
